Research Abstract

This research is to seize the real condition of using wood resources in West Europe and North America in Post-Pleistocene and clarify the characteristics of Jomon Culture - 'Forest Culture'. But I found, as a result of collecting resources in Europe and the U. S., there were few data compared to wooden artifacts in Jomon in quantity and quality.
Therefore I selected information of great value among many accounts aiming to further developments of this study and showed it in this report.
1. Studies on wetland sites
This chapter consists of translations and summarizations of papers concerning wetland sites in three selected areas, England, Ireland and Denmark.
2. Studies on technology of wooden artifacts
It proved that there were few studies on the technology except 'cut-marks' in Post-Pleistocene. This chapter gives the ethnographical study on the technology of North-west Coast Indians.
3. Studies on logboats
The emergence of logboats is a world-wide characteristics in Post-Pleistocene. This chapter comprises studies of them in Europe and North America, and my case study on Japanese logboats.
